Solution
The Z170 MB can't support the i7 6850K, because the 6850K is the lga2011-3, if you want the 6850K you need buy the x99 MB. If you want that Z170, either i7 7700K or 6700K.


The answers are yes for your questions, because as long as the MB has the pcie x16 slot, the GPU will fit. Also the MB is the atx format, the mid tower case should support up to atx format MB ( you don't list what case you have)

But there are two questions you should think about, 1) can gtx1080 fit into your thermaltake mid tower case? Even the GPU is only 10.5" in length, just double check. 2) the MB is the Z170, if you will buy the 7th gen cpu, you will need to update the BIOS first by the USB BIOS Flashback. Otherwise the PC will not boot.
